GenSight Biologics announced the successful completion of a €2.9 million fundraising round on December 29, 2025, bringing the company's total fundraising for the year to over €13 million. The latest round was subscribed by three existing shareholders: Heights Capital (搜索), Invus (搜索), and Alumni Capital (搜索), following previous fundraisings of €4.5 million in July, €3.7 million in October, and €2 million in November.
The Paris-based biopharma company, which focuses on developing gene therapies for retinal neurodegenerative diseases (搜索) and central nervous system disorders (搜索), plans to allocate approximately 73% of the net proceeds to finance continued development of its lead product candidate, GS010/LUMEVOQ®.
Regulatory Milestones Drive Momentum
"2025 has been a transformative year for GenSight Biologics," said Laurence Rodriguez, Chief Executive Officer. "Securing compassionate use approvals in three major markets—the United States, France, and Israel—represent a significant regulatory milestone."
The compassionate use approvals mark a critical inflection point for GS010, which is currently in Phase III clinical development for Leber Hereditary Optic Neuropathy (搜索) (LHON (搜索)), a rare mitochondrial disease (搜索) that causes irreversible blindness in teens and young adults. The gene therapy is designed to be administered as a single treatment to each eye via intravitreal injection.
Financial Strategy and Cash Runway
The fundraising extends GenSight's cash runway through February 2026, with revenues from compassionate access programs in France and Israel expected to ensure operational continuity through the remainder of 2026. As of November 30, 2025, the company reported cash and cash equivalents of €1.8 million and financial debt of €24.4 million.
"The various bridge financing rounds since early 2024 demonstrate the unwavering confidence of our investors, enabling us to advance steadily with our programs," said Jan Eryk Umiastowski, Chief Financial Officer. "The compassionate use approvals secured in the United States, France, and Israel mark an inflection point that positions us well for our next phase of growth."
The company structured the fundraising through the issuance of 30.4 million ordinary shares, 6.6 million pre-funded warrants, and 37 million investor warrants, with shares priced at €0.08 representing a 20% discount to the December 24 closing price.
Technology Platform and Pipeline
GenSight's pipeline leverages two core technology platforms: the Mitochondrial Targeting Sequence (搜索) (MTS (搜索)) and optogenetics. The company's approach aims to preserve or restore vision in patients suffering from blinding retinal diseases through gene therapy interventions.
GS010 utilizes the company's proprietary mitochondrial targeting technology and has not yet received marketing authorization in any jurisdiction. The therapy is designed to offer patients sustainable functional visual recovery through its targeted approach to mitochondrial dysfunction underlying LHON (搜索).
Future Funding Strategy
Beyond the current cash runway, GenSight continues to pursue multiple financing options to support the RECOVER Phase III trial and prepare for potential marketing authorization applications. The company is actively exploring non-dilutive financing opportunities including licensing agreements outside North America and Europe, expansion of Early Access Programs beyond France, strategic partnerships, and potential mergers and acquisitions.
The company also plans to support filing of a marketing authorization application with the MHRA in the United Kingdom for GS010/LUMEVOQ® as part of its broader regulatory strategy.
The offered shares are expected to be admitted to trading on Euronext Paris on December 31, 2025, with the new shares carrying current dividend rights and trading under the existing ISIN code FR0013183985.
